Anyone interested in going to DC for the Sept. 24 Rally/March? |
|
Edited on Fri Aug-26-05 12:52 AM by kiteinthewind
We are taking a Bus for the people that can only go for Sat. and the Van is for people who can stay through Monday.
The Bus and Van will both leave together at noon on Friday, Sept. 23 and arrive in D.C. Saturday morning. The Bus will leave D.C. late Saturday evening and return to Kansas City on Sunday evening. The cost per seat is $130.
The Van will leave D.C. area on Monday late afternoon and return to Kansas City Tuesday afternoon or evening, Sept. 27. For those who want to save money or who love to camp, I have found a campground in Virginia by a lake that is 8 miles from one of the Rail stations to D.C. They have shaded camp sights, flush toilets, hot/cold showers, and sinks. The cost is about $5 per person per night, or $10 per person, total. There is also a nearby Day’s Inn that costs about $80 per night, so If 2 people share a room the cost for both nights will be about $80 each. As people pay for their tickets, I will find out if they want to camp or share a hotel room. then I will share emails for roommate purposes. The van will leave the campground on Sunday and Monday mornings and swing by the hotel to pick up the hotel people on the way to the Rail station. The cost of the van per seat is $130, which includes rental, gasoline, and sandwich stuff and snacks for the trip to and from D.C. Each person will need to bring some cash for the Rail into D.C. (I would approx. $15) and food for lunches and dinners on Sat, Sun, and Mon.
